what is calmag?
Cal mag Plus (different from reg cal mag? idk)
2-0-0
Calcium, Magnesium and Iron supplement by Botanicare
Recommended application rate normally is sufficient to make up for any deficiences in most soil or hydroponic formulas. Note - In hydroponics, iron falls out of the solution relatively fast due to use of magnetic driven pumps without grounding probes and high levels of dissolved oxygen from air stones and pumps.
thats the directions on the back of the bottle
Mostly its used for ppl who use Reverse Osmosis/distilled water because it contains no additives this product makes up for
Faucet water should contain these things, but I use cal-mag with it anyway since I got my nutrients in a package
